FDS with detuning around 50Hz

Aritomi, Eleonora, Yuhang

We tried to measure FDS with correct detuning (this time produced squeezing level is only 5 dB and we are thinking temperature may be responsible for this change). However, low frequency part is dominated by back scattering as expected.

Good thing is that the rotation part of the curve is still visible from the noise curve. We are also thinking to increase the average times to further reduce the spectrum curve thickness, so that the rotation part can be more clear. It's also better to analyze the data as soon as we take it and if it's not correct detuning, we should tune the detuning and take the data again.
